Error while publishing Eventstream

Failed to commit topology

According to the error message in your screenshot: Failed to commit topology Error code: 22, error message: Failed to execute 'setltem' on 'Storage': Setting the value of '....' This error typically occurs when the browser's local or session storage is full, or the data you are trying to save exceeds the allocated storage quota. Considering the environment in which you are working with Eventstream in Microsoft Fabric, this may be related to capacity limitations in the fabric environment or browser limitations.

Please start by clearing your browser's cache and local storage. This can sometimes resolve issues related to storage quotas being exceeded.
Ensure that your Eventstream configuration does not exceed the limits set by Microsoft Fabric. This includes checking the size and number of sources, transformations, and destinations configured in your Eventstream (max: 11).
Review the current capacity and usage in your Microsoft Fabric environment. If you're nearing or exceeding capacity limits, consider scaling your resources.
Understand your Fabric capacity throttling - Microsoft Fabric | Microsoft Learn
And if possible, optimize your Eventstream by reducing the complexity or size of the data being processed. This might involve filtering data at the source or reducing the number of transformations.
